The reputed company Compliance Investigator will be responsible for leading investigations relating to potential violations of law or other reputed company Policies. These investigations may be allegations of Conflict of Interest, Reporting and Recordkeeping violations, Respectful Workplace allegations (harassment/discrimination) or other Compliance areas. The reputed company Compliance Investigator will (1) conduct investigations of policy concerns raised through the open reporting system; (2) provide regular updates on investigations to business stakeholders. (3) facilitate cross-training and report-outs with the broader compliance function at reputed company. This role will report to the Sr. Compliance Investigations Manager – Americas. in the reputed company Compliance function. Essential Responsibilities
- reputed company investigations of policy concerns raised through the open reporting system
- Provide regular updates on the status of cases to business stakeholders.
- Conduct reputed company, thorough and reputed company investigations, including conducting interviews with concern raisers, witnesses and subjects, assessing risk, reviewing documentation, and making recommendations/corrective actions in the context of an investigation; in partnership with Compliance, L&E and the HR Manager, as appropriate.
- Prepare high quality written reports of the investigation which provide a clear and logical account of the allegations, investigative work performed, key findings and conclusions, ensuring that the conclusion is evidence based.
- Provide briefings to senior leaders on investigative matters as required.
- Maintain client relationships in the face of conflicting demands or directions.
- Monitor open cases assigned to you to ensure timeline and compliant closure, using established guidelines
- Conduct investigations reputed company your immediate region as required
- Partner with Compliance, Ombuds and other functions to identify and understand investigations trends and corrective actions
- In partnership with Labor & Employment, understand and apply legal and policy requirements pertaining to the conduct of investigations including in areas involving employee interviews and relevant labor and employment requirements.
